    A telehealth company can have hundreds of clinicians in its network and still struggle to find the right provider for the next patient.

    Imagine a patient in Florida looking for a particular virtual care service. The company has 100 providers, but most can't take that patient. Some do not serve Florida, some work in different programs, and others already have full schedules or review queues. Suddenly, a network of 100 providers may offer only a handful of realistic options.

    That is why a telehealth provider network is more than a list of clinicians. In practice, the network has one job: connect each patient with a provider who can actually care for them. Doing that reliably means considering location, licensing, service type, availability, and workload before assigning a patient.

    For a growing telehealth business, the important question is not simply “How many providers do we have?”

    It is “Can we get the right patient to the right provider when care is needed?”

    A Large Provider Network Can Still Be Too Small

    Provider count looks impressive on a dashboard, but it says little about how much care a business can actually deliver.

    Suppose a telehealth company has 150 clinicians. A patient enters the platform and requests a specific service. The patient is located in a state where only 25 of those providers can practice. Of those 25, perhaps 10 work in the relevant program. Several are unavailable, while others already have full workloads.

    The company may technically have 150 providers, but only a few are realistic options for that particular patient.

    This gives telehealth companies a more useful way to think about network size:

    All providers → Providers who can serve the patient → Providers who fit the service → Providers with capacity → Provider assigned

    A strong network makes those filters part of the workflow instead of asking employees to check each one manually.

    The Right Provider Depends on the Patient

    In a simple booking system, matching can look like a calendar problem: find an available provider and book the appointment.

    Telehealth makes the decision more complicated.

    The right provider may depend on:

    • where the patient is located;
    • what service the patient needs;
    • the provider's licensing or other applicable practice authority;
    • provider type or specialty;
    • whether care is synchronous or asynchronous;
    • current availability and workload;
    • program participation;
    • continuity with an existing provider, where relevant.

    These factors need to come together before assignment.

    If they do not, staff become responsible for connecting the pieces. One person checks the patient's status, another spreadsheet shows provider licenses, a scheduling system shows appointments, and another system contains the provider's current workload.

    That may be manageable with a small patient base. As volume increases, however, manual matching slows and becomes harder to maintain.

    A better telehealth provider network brings the information needed for assignment into the workflow itself.

    Geography Is Part of Provider Availability

    Telehealth lets patients and providers meet without being in the same physical location, but that doesn't mean every provider can automatically treat patients everywhere.

    Telehealth.HHS.gov explains in its licensure guidance that healthcare professionals need to meet applicable licensing requirements. When practicing across state lines, providers generally need to be licensed or otherwise legally permitted to practice in the state where the patient is located.

    Different pathways may be available depending on the profession and jurisdiction. These can include full licenses, interstate compacts, reciprocity arrangements, temporary practice laws, or telehealth registration.

    For a telehealth company, this means geographic and provider expansion must happen together.

    A marketing team may be able to start advertising in another state almost immediately. Clinical capacity cannot necessarily expand at the same speed.

    Before entering another market, the business needs to know whether it has enough appropriate providers to support the patients it expects to acquire.

    Business Wants To...Provider Network Needs To Answer...
    Launch in another stateDo we have appropriate provider coverage there?
    Increase marketing spendCan providers absorb more patient demand?
    Add a new care programWhich providers can deliver that service?
    Offer faster accessIs enough provider capacity actually available?
    Expand nationallyWhere are the network's coverage gaps?

    That is why national availability isn't simply a marketing decision. It is also a clinical operations decision.

    Licensing Information Should Help Route the Patient

    Tracking provider licenses is important. Using that information at the right moment is even more useful.

    Imagine a patient is ready to be assigned to a provider. If an employee first chooses a clinician and then checks whether that clinician can appropriately serve the patient's location, the business has created another manual step.

    The workflow can instead use known provider and patient information earlier:

    Patient location → Eligible providers → Service fit → Availability → Assignment

    Telehealth.HHS.gov's cross-state licensing guidance also recommends confirming the patient's location before an appointment and describes the different pathways states may use for cross-state telehealth practice.

    Technology does not decide whether a clinician is legally permitted to treat a particular patient. Applicable laws, licensing rules, provider type, and individual circumstances determine that.

    Technology can make relevant provider information available when the assignment is made.

    That prevents licensing data from becoming something staff maintain in one system but forget to check in another.

    Coverage Does Not Always Mean Capacity

    Suppose a telehealth company has five providers who can serve patients in a particular state.

    The company can say that the state is covered.

    But what happens when all five providers are already busy?

    The business still has geographic coverage, but it may not have enough capacity to serve another patient promptly.

    This matters even more because telehealth provider work does not always show up as an appointment on a calendar. A provider may be reviewing patient submissions, completing follow-up work, responding to clinical messages, documenting encounters, or handling other responsibilities.

    A blank calendar therefore does not always mean a clinician is available.

    Bask's article on healthcare scheduling software explores this problem in greater detail. In many telehealth workflows, scheduling is not only about finding an open appointment. It can also involve distributing work based on provider availability, patient location, program fit, and current workload.

    For the provider network, the lesson is straightforward:

    Do not measure capacity only by empty appointment slots. Measure the work providers already have.

    Asynchronous Care Changes How Provider Work Is Assigned

    A traditional appointment calendar makes provider workload relatively easy to see. If every appointment slot is filled, the provider is probably close to capacity.

    Asynchronous care works differently.

    A patient may complete an intake or submit information without scheduling a live visit. An appropriate provider then reviews the case within the organization's clinical workflow. Instead of appointments, part of the provider's workload now appears as a queue.

    Consider two providers.

    • Provider A has no video appointment for the next hour but has 20 patient submissions waiting for review.
    • Provider B has one video appointment but only three cases waiting in the review queue.

    If the system looks only at the calendar, Provider A may appear more available. Once you factor in workload, the picture changes.

    This is why a telehealth provider network needs to understand more than schedules. It needs enough information about current work to avoid repeatedly sending new patients to clinicians who already have full queues.

    The goal is not to push providers through as many patients as possible. Clinical complexity and professional judgment still matter.

    The goal is to distribute work intentionally rather than letting it accumulate wherever it lands.

    Patient Matching Should Be Simple for Staff

    Provider matching can involve several rules, but employees shouldn't have to rebuild those rules for every patient.

    A practical routing process can work in stages.

    First, determine who can serve the patient. Patient location and applicable provider requirements narrow the network.

    Next, determine who fits the service. A provider may be available but not participate in the relevant program or type of care.

    Then consider continuity where it matters. Existing patient-provider relationships may affect how follow-up care is routed.

    Finally, look at actual capacity. Compare remaining providers by availability and current workload.

    This creates a much stronger assignment process than simply sending the patient to whoever appears first on an availability list.

    It also makes the workflow easier to explain. Staff does not need to memorize dozens of provider combinations because the system can use the information already available to narrow the options.

    Marketing Growth Needs Provider Capacity Behind It

    A telehealth company launches a successful campaign and patient demand rises by 40%.

    That sounds like good news.

    But if the provider network has not prepared for the increase, the business may soon see longer queues, fewer available appointments, slower responses, heavier provider workloads, and more questions from patients waiting for care.

    A marketing win can quickly become an operations problem.

    This is why provider capacity should be part of growth planning.

    Before significantly increasing patient acquisition, operators should understand:

    • which markets have available provider capacity;
    • which programs are already busy;
    • where provider coverage is thin;
    • how quickly more capacity can be added;
    • whether asynchronous queues are growing;
    • whether appointment availability is shrinking;
    • where patient demand is rising fastest.

    Marketing teams do not need access to clinical records to understand these patterns. The business needs operational information showing whether its clinical network can support the demand it plans to create.

    When patient growth and provider planning happen separately, patients often experience the gap first.

    Adding a Provider Does Not Add Capacity Immediately

    Recruiting a clinician is only the beginning.

    Before a new provider can begin working within a telehealth network, the organization may need to complete applicable onboarding steps, verify credentials and licensing information, configure system access, connect the provider with relevant programs, establish availability, and make sure the clinician understands the platform and workflow.

    That creates an important difference:

    Provider recruited ≠ Provider ready to receive patients

    For a growing business, the time between those two points matters.

    Suppose a company expects patient demand in one state to exceed current capacity next month. If it waits until the shortage appears to begin provider recruitment and onboarding, patients may face delays while the company prepares additional capacity.

    Provider planning should therefore look ahead.

    The network needs to know not only how much capacity exists today but also where additional capacity may be needed next.

    Provider Information Cannot Become Stale.

    The provider network continues changing after clinicians are onboarded.

    Licenses may need renewal. Availability changes. Providers join or leave programs. Schedules change. New states are added. A clinician may temporarily stop accepting new patients.

    Telehealth.HHS.gov notes that licenses must be maintained and renewed, and that requirements can include fees, continuing education, and other state- or profession-specific obligations.

    If provider information affects patient assignment, keeping that information current becomes part of the operating workflow.

    A six-month-old spreadsheet may accurately describe the network that existed six months ago. It does not necessarily describe the network that can serve a patient today.

    Telehealth companies therefore need a reliable way to maintain the provider information they use for routing and capacity planning.

    The goal is not administrative perfection. It is to avoid situations where outdated information sends a patient to a provider who is no longer an appropriate option.

    Better Provider Workflows Can Create More Usable Capacity

    Recruiting more clinicians is not the only way to expand a provider network.

    Sometimes the business can recover capacity from the providers it already has.

    Imagine clinicians spending part of every case searching for patient information, switching between systems, copying data, checking whether intake was completed, or doing administrative tasks that could happen elsewhere in the workflow.

    Those minutes add up.

    If providers spend less time on unnecessary administrative work, more of their working time remains available for tasks that actually require clinical expertise.

    This is why the provider-facing workflow matters.

    Providers should have relevant patient information when they need it. Intake should connect naturally with the clinical record. Scheduling or queue information should not live in isolation. Prescribing and communication workflows should not require clinicians to rebuild patient context every time they move between tools.

    A Growing Network Needs Clear Access Controls

    As more providers and staff join a telehealth organization, more people may need access to different parts of the digital-care environment.

    That does not mean everyone should see everything.

    The HIPAA Security Rule requires regulated entities to manage access to electronic protected health information according to appropriate workforce roles and responsibilities. HHS explains these requirements in its summary of the HIPAA Security Rule.

    HHS's minimum necessary guidance also explains the Privacy Rule's general requirement to make reasonable efforts to limit certain uses, disclosures, and requests for protected health information to the minimum necessary for their intended purpose, while noting exceptions such as disclosures to or requests by healthcare providers for treatment.

    For a telehealth provider network, the practical point is that access should follow what people actually need to do.

    Providers may need clinical information to care for patients. Operations teams may need different information to manage workflows. Administrative staff may have other responsibilities.

    As the network grows, permissions should stay tied to those roles rather than broadening simply because managing access has become more complicated.

    What Happens When No Provider Fits?

    A good provider network also needs to know what to do when normal matching fails.

    Suppose a patient enters the platform and no provider currently meets all of the necessary conditions.

    Perhaps the business serves the patient's state, but every appropriate provider is at capacity. Maybe the network does not yet have the required coverage. A provider may have become unavailable after assignment, or the patient may need a different type of care than the standard workflow expected.

    These cases need somewhere to go.

    Instead of leaving the patient in a generic unassigned queue, the organization should be able to distinguish the problem.

    No capacity: Appropriate providers exist, but none currently have room.

    No coverage: The network does not currently have an appropriate provider for that patient or market.

    Needs review: The patient's situation doesn't fit the standard routing path and requires human review.

    These are different problems and usually require different responses.

    More recruiting may help a coverage shortage. Better workload distribution may help a capacity problem. Neither necessarily solves a patient case that requires individual review.

    The faster the organization can identify the problem, the faster it can respond appropriately.

    Measure Whether Patients Can Actually Reach Providers

    The number of clinicians in the network is useful information, but it should not be the main measure of network performance.

    The better question is whether patients can reach appropriate providers without unnecessary delays or manual coordination.

    Depending on the care model, useful operational measures may include:

    • active providers by market;
    • available capacity by service or program;
    • time from patient readiness to provider assignment;
    • appointment availability;
    • asynchronous queue size;
    • age of unreviewed cases;
    • percentage of patients requiring manual routing;
    • markets with limited provider coverage;
    • frequency of capacity shortages;
    • provider workload distribution;
    • time required to bring new providers into the workflow.

    These numbers should be interpreted together.

    For example, very high provider utilization may look efficient until it leaves the network with no room to absorb a sudden increase in demand. Likewise, adding ten providers may sound like growth but matter little if they do not expand coverage or capacity where patients actually need it.

    A better question than “How many providers did we add?” is:

    “Did patients gain better access because we added them?”

    How Bask Health Supports Provider Network Operations

    A provider network becomes harder to manage when patient intake, provider information, scheduling, clinical records, communication, and downstream workflows all live in separate systems.

    Bask Health brings multiple parts of the digital-care environment together, including patient and provider portals, patient management, scheduling, EMR and e-prescribing capabilities, secure communication, pharmacy connectivity, analytics, and integrations.

    For a telehealth provider network, the value of that connected environment is straightforward: providers and patients can move through the same broader workflow instead of relying on staff to manually connect separate systems.

    Patient information collected during intake can flow into the appropriate clinical workflow. Provider assignments can remain connected with the patient journey. Scheduling and provider work can sit alongside patient management, while integrations and APIs can extend the environment when the business uses additional systems.

    This does not replace the organization's responsibility for provider recruitment, licensing, credentialing, clinical policies, or appropriate staffing decisions.

    It helps provide the infrastructure around those responsibilities.

    Build the Network for the Next Patient

    A telehealth provider network should ultimately be tested one patient at a time.

    When someone enters the system, can the business quickly identify an appropriate provider? Does it know whether that provider can serve the patient's location and service? Can it see whether the clinician actually has room for another case? If nobody is available, does the organization know why?

    Those questions reveal much more than the total number of providers in a database.

    As a telehealth business expands into more markets and programs, the network becomes core infrastructure. Recruiting brings clinicians into that network, but provider information, routing, workload visibility, access controls, and connected workflows determine how useful the network actually becomes.

    The strongest telehealth provider network is not the one with the longest provider list. It is the one that can reliably connect the next patient with the right clinical capacity.
